Best Quotes about Law and lawyers

1.
The severity of the laws prevents their execution.
Montesquieu, Charles De

2.
The state calls its own violence law, but that of the individual crime.
Stirner, Max

3.
The law was made for one thing alone, for the exploitation of those who don't understand it, or are prevented by naked misery from obeying it.
Brecht, Bertolt

4.
The trouble with law is lawyers.
Darrow, Clarence

5.
Are not laws dangerous which inhibit the passions? Compare the centuries of anarchy with those of the strongest legalism in any country you like and you will see that it is only when the laws are silent that the greatest actions appear.
Sade, Marquis De

6.
The magistrates are the ministers for the laws, the judges their interpreters, the rest of us are servants of the law, that we all may be free.
Cicero, Marcus T.

7.
Laws are the sovereigns of sovereigns.
Louis XIV

8.
A lawyer with his briefcase can steal more than a hundred men with guns.
Puzo, Mario

9.
If lawyers are disbarred and clergymen defrocked, doesn't it follow that electricians can be delighted, musicians denoted, cowboys deranged, models deposed, tree surgeons debarked, and dry cleaners depressed.
Ostman, Virginia

10.
The good lawyer is not the man who has an eye to every side and angle of contingency, and qualifies all his qualifications, but who throws himself on your part so heartily, that he can get you out of a scrape.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

11.
The more corrupt the state, the more laws.
Tacitus, Publius Cornelius

12.
Law cannot persuade when it cannot punish.
Saying

13.
It is impossible for us to break the law. We can only break ourselves against the law.
Mille, Cecil B. De

14.
Here lies one believe it if you can, who thought an attorney, was a honest man.
Epitaph

15.
We should have learnt by now that laws and court decisions can only point the way. They can establish criteria of right and wrong. And they can provide a basis for rooting out the evils of bigotry and racism. But they cannot wipe away centuries of oppression and injustice -- however much we might desire it.
Humphrey, Hubert H.

16.
Even an attorney of moderate talent can postpone doomsday year after year, for the system of appeals that pervades American jurisprudence amounts to a legalistic wheel of fortune, a game of chance, somewhat fixed in the favor of the criminal, that the participants play interminably.
Capote, Truman

17.
No great idea in its beginning can ever be within the law. How can it be within the law? The law is stationary. The law is fixed. The law is a chariot wheel which binds us all regardless of conditions or place or time.
Goldman, Emma

18.
I would uphold the law if for no other reason but to protect myself.
Moore, Thomas

19.
Under any conditions, anywhere, whatever you are doing, there is some ordinance under which you can be booked.
Sprecht, Robert D.

20.
Law and order exist for the purpose of establishing justice and when they fail in this purpose they become the dangerously structured dams that block the flow of social progress.
King Jr. Martin Luther

21.
People crushed by laws, have no hope but to evade power. If the laws are their enemies, they will be enemies to the law; and those who have must to hope and nothing to lose will always be dangerous.
Burke, Edmund

22.
When the severity of the law is to be softened, let pity, not bribes, be the motive.
Cervantes, Miguel De

23.
A lawyers dream of heaven; every man reclaimed his property at the resurrection, and each tried to recover it from all his forefathers.
Butler, Samuel

24.
Young lawyers attend the courts, not because they have business there, but because they have no business.
Irving, Washington

25.
Who thinks the law has anything to do with justice? It's what we have because we can't have justice.
Mcilvanney, William

26.
Our demands are simple, normal, and therefore they are difficult to satisfy. All we ask is that an actor on the stage live in accordance with natural laws
Stanislavisky, Konstantin

27.
I have spent all my life under a Communist regime, and I will tell you that a society without any objective legal scale is a terrible one indeed. But a society with no other scale but the legal one is not quite worthy of man either.
Solzhenitsyn, Alexander

28.
The law helps those who watch, not those who sleep.
Proverb

29.
Some laws of state aimed at curbing crime are even more criminal.
Engels, Friedrich

30.
A good lawyer is a bad neighbor.
Proverb, French

31.
Good laws make it easier to do right and harder to do wrong.
Gladstone, William E.

32.
We may not all break the Ten Commandments, but we are certainly all capable of it. Within us lurks the breaker of all laws, ready to spring out at the first real opportunity.
Duncan, Isadora

33.
I was never ruined but twice; once when I lost a lawsuit and once when I won one.
Voltaire

34.
The first thing we do, lets kill the lawyers. [Henry Iv]
Shakespeare, William

35.
Lawyers are like rhinoceroses: thick skinned, short-sighted, and always ready to charge.
Mellor, David

36.
The spirit of moderation should also be the spirit of the lawgiver.
Montesquieu, Charles De

37.
I want to live perfectly above the law, and make it my servant instead of my master.
Young, Brigham

38.
The court is like a palace of marble; it's composed of people very hard and very polished.
La Bruyere, Jean De

39.
Scarcely any political question arises in the United States that is not resolved, sooner or later, into a judicial question.
Tocqueville, Alexis De

40.
A jury too often has at least one member more ready to hang the panel than to hang the traitor.
Lincoln, Abraham

41.
Written laws are like spider's webs; they will catch, it is true, the weak and the poor, but would be torn in pieces by the rich and powerful.
Anacharsis

42.
The judge is found guilty when a criminal is acquitted.
Syrus, Publilius

43.
Petty laws breed great crimes.
Ouida

44.
I said there was a society of men among us, bred up from their youth in the art of proving by words multiplied for the purpose, that white is black, and black is white, according as they are paid. To this society all the rest of the people are as slaves.
Swift, Jonathan

45.
I would be loath to speak ill of any person who I do not know deserves it, but I am afraid he is an attorney.
Johnson, Samuel

46.
In cross examination, as in fishing, nothing is more ungainly than a fisherman pulled into the water by his catch.
Nizer, Louis

47.
In a democracy -- even if it is a so-called democracy like our white-?litist one -- the greatest veneration one can show the rule of law is to keep a watch on it, and to reserve the right to judge unjust laws and the subversion of the function of the law by the power of the state. That vigilance is the most important proof of respect for the law.
Gordimer, Nadine

48.
This is a court of law young man, not a court of justice.
Holmes, Oliver Wendell

49.
Law and equity are two things which God has joined, but which man has put asunder.
Colton, Charles Caleb

50.
It is unfair to believe everything we hear about lawyers, some of it might not be true.
Lieberman, Gerald F.
